Thank you for your interest in volunteering! Abilities Tennis Association of NC (ATANC) is thrilled to partner with Durham County Special Olympics and ENO Tennis Association to provide free, friendly tennis clinics for those with intellectual disabilities ages 8 and up.
Volunteers play an important role in making these clinics possible for the athletes. We do require that you have some level of tennis knowledge.
Volunteers will help on the courts assisting with ball and racquet drills to help teach the Abilities athletes the highly adaptive game of tennis. Abilities athletes range in skill level with some learning how to hold and swing a racquet to hit red-dot starter balls and others playing full court with regular yellow balls.
